WebJan 17, 2024 · The last step, to filter feeding. Flamingos are full on filter feeders that use a modified beak, as a turtle must. They accomplish this via a specialized and versatile tongue that keeps the food in the middle and expels the water to the sides, and lamella along the beak. Filter feeding in flamingos. WebMar 10, 2024 · The motor, filter box and filter cartridge are submerged in the aquarium. Water recirculates through the filter cartridge and back into the tank. Internal power filters range in size from tiny for nano aquariums up to tanks around 30 gallons. The filters attach to the aquarium by suction cups or a clip that hangs on the side of the tank.
